Canadian films grabbed the spotlight at the just-concluded Karlovy Vary International Film Festival, with Aaron Houston’s Sunflower Hour taking home Czech Television’s Independent Camera Award.
Other Canadian winners include Roméo Onze, from Montreal filmmaker Ivan Grbovic, earning a special mention in the Ecumenical Jury Award competition, and Martin Donovan’s Collaborator, a Canadian-U.S. co-venture coproduced by Luca Matrundola of DViant Films, grabbing the best actor award for David Morse, and the international film critics, or FIPRESCI, prize.
The Czech film festival also staged a tribute to Denis Villeneuve, with the Canadian filmmaker in attendance.
